Psalm 37:14-16
International Children’s Bible
14 The wicked draw their swords.
They bend their bows.
They try to kill the poor and helpless.
They want to kill those who are honest.
15 But their swords will stab their own hearts.
Their bows will break.
16 It’s better to have little and be right
than to have much and be wrong.
Psalm 37:14-16
New International Version
14 The wicked draw the sword(A)
and bend the bow(B)
to bring down the poor and needy,(C)
to slay those whose ways are upright.
15 But their swords will pierce their own hearts,(D)
and their bows will be broken.(E)
16 Better the little that the righteous have
than the wealth(F) of many wicked;
